Wire-grid polarizers (WGPs) can be fabricated easily by reversal rigiflex printing. Metal films with gratings were fabricated on a transparent glass substrate by transfer printing with a metal coated rigiflex mold, and the transferred metal gratings were then etched slightly to eliminate the residual layer. As a result, aligned metal wires (70 nm line/space width, 120 nm height) occupying an area of 3.0 cm × 2.5 cm were obtained. The maximum and minimum transmittances of a WGP replicated from a commercial Moxtek polarizer at 800 nm were 85% and 27%, respectively.
